Fórum Ubuntu CZ/SK
Ostatní => Ubuntu Server => Téma založeno: mafka 18 Března 2013, 20:45:34
-
Ahoj, projel sem zde návody ke zprovoznění LAMP serverů ale žádný mi nepomohl vyřešit můj problém s phpmyadminem.
Věc se má tak, že jsem klasicky pres tasksel instaloval celý LAMP server a vše šlo. K mému překvapení, druhý den phpmyadmin byl nedostupný z adresy http://localhost/phpmyadmin (http://localhost/phpmyadmin)
Phpmyadmin se vůbec nenachází ve složce /var/www, je pouze v /usr/share/phpmyadmin a poté je soubor config-db.php v /etc/phpmyadmin/ takže netuším co vlastně nalinkovat aby se mi zobrazil :-[
kompletně jsem ho přeinstaloval přes apt-get ale nebyl mi nabídnut přidružený server.
Jen dodám že zobrazování souborů na localhostu funguje, jde jen o to jak se dostat do phpmyadmin.
Předem všem děkuju za veškeré rady jak bych dosáhl zprovoznění.
-
Pokud máš webový server nainstalovaný a spuštěný, tak zkus tohle:
sudo dpkg-reconfigure -plow phpmyadmin
V případě, že to apache nenabídne, tak použij tyto příkazy pro nalinkování do apache:
sudo ln -s /etc/phpmyadmin/apache.conf /etc/apache2/conf.d/phpmyadmin.conf
sudo /etc/init.d/apache2 reload
-
Děkuju za odpověd a přesunutí :)
první možnost jsem využil, databázi jsem ponechal stejnou čili jen přidal apache, výstup byl tedy takový
masi@masi-compaq ~ $ sudo dpkg-reconfigure -plow phpmyadmin
[sudo] password for masi:
dbconfig-common: writing config to /etc/dbconfig-common/phpmyadmin.conf
Replacing config file /etc/phpmyadmin/config-db.php with new version
ln: symbolický odkaz „/etc/apache2/conf.d/phpmyadmin.conf“ nebylo možné vytvořit: Soubor již existuje
avšak problém nastal s restartem apache, který nenašel konfigurační soubor phpmyadmin :/
masi@masi-compaq ~ $ sudo /etc/init.d/apache2 restart
apache2: Syntax error on line 234 of /etc/apache2/apache2.conf: Could not open configuration file /etc/apache2/conf.d/phpmyadmin.conf: No such file or directory
Action 'configtest' failed.
The Apache error log may have more information.
...fail!